Abstract (EN)

In this study, the design and production of battery packaging and Battery Management System (BMS) for electric vehicles were carried out. The focus of the study is to develop the necessary monitoring and control mechanisms to ensure that battery systems operate safely, efficiently, and with extended service life. In the developed system, battery voltage, temperature, and State of Charge (SoC) data are continuously monitored and transmitted to the user in real-time. This provides real-time information about the operational status of the batteries, ensuring a safe and stable working environment. The produced Battery Management System enables the monitoring of battery temperature, voltage, and current values, allowing for the early detection of potential anomalies and facilitating predictive maintenance. Additionally, it provides comprehensive data management to optimize battery performance, extend lifespan, and improve operational efficiency.
